New York Court of Appeals

In the Matter of State of New York, Respondent v. Michael M., Appellant

December 19, 201424 N.Y.3d 649

Summary

The New York Court of Appeals reversed the Appellate Division’s order committing Michael M. to a secure treatment facility, holding that the evidence was legally insufficient to show he was a dangerous sex offender requiring confinement and that the least‑restrictive‑alternative doctrine does not apply to article 10 civil commitments. The matter was remitted to the Supreme Court for further proceedings.
